Hello I am Shannon,
What led me to become a therapist wasn’t just professional curiosity, it was personal. I grew up in a household shaped by domestic violence and addiction, and from an early age I was on a path of learning how to survive, understand, and eventually heal. That journey planted the seeds for a lifelong interest in self-development, compassion, and understanding the complexities of human behaviour.
Later in life, I found success in the entertainment and dance industry, but eventually experienced deep burnout. At the heart of that burnout was a disconnection from my own authenticity. I had built a life that looked successful on the outside, but inside, I had lost touch with myself. That realisation was a turning point. I stepped back to reassess what truly mattered—my health, boundaries, and truth.
Even then, I was drawn to mental health, weaving emotional support and psychological awareness into my work with dancers and students. I began to see clearly how healing isn’t about fixing something that’s broken, it’s about reconnecting with who we truly are, with curiosity and compassion.
A key part of that reconnection, for me, has always been the body. I learned firsthand how deeply profound and important our relationship with the body is. I truly believe that my connection to movement and dance is what saved me, it gave me a safe, embodied way to move through trauma, regulate my nervous system, and stay connected to myself. That’s why I chose to specialise in somatic therapy: because I understand the transformative power of embodiment and how the body holds the truth of our experiences.
Healing, to me, is about coming home to yourself and the body is where that home lives.

Why I Don't Work Hour-by-Hour Anymore
Over my years working with somatic psychotherapy and nervous system regulation, I have come to realise that even though the deepest shifts happen within our 60 minutes together in a session, the real challenge is during the week, when you are in the real world trying to apply a grounding tool, process an emotional wave, or stabilise your system.
When you are navigating deep emotional overwhelm, chronic stress, or long-standing trauma responses, your nervous system is operating in survival mode. Real, lasting shift doesn’t happen in a single, isolated hour of therapy every now and then.
Safety requires consistency. True transformation needs a steady, predictable rhythm so your body can actually let its guard down, integrate the tools, and begin to heal.
Because of this, I have stepped away from the traditional, ad-hoc session model and created my own unique model. I work with my ongoing clients inside dedicated Care Containers. This means you aren’t just booking a casual appointment; you are investing in a structured, supported, and sustainable pathway toward long-term nervous system regulation, trauma recovery, stress management & long lasting neuroplastic & emotional change.
Healing happens out in the real world, not just on the therapy couch. This structure ensures you are fully supported in the messy spaces between our sessions:

How We Begin
We build the relationship first. We don't jump straight into the container, we ensure absolute alignment.
1. The Initial Consultation
Every journey starts with a one-off initial session (available to book online in-person or via Telehealth. We will slow down, map out your unique nervous system blueprint, get to know each other, understand your baseline and see if working together feels aligned.
2. Crafting Your Structure
At the end of our first session, if we are a great clinical fit, I will honestly assess your system’s needs and recommend the matching container structure for your system's needs:
The Integration Container ($105/week): For steady, sustainable lifestyle pacing. Includes fortnightly 60-minute sessions, continuous mid-week text/voice support, and full app access.
The Deep Dive Container ($200/week): For acute support, deep trauma processing, or major life transitions. Includes weekly 60-minute sessions, priority mid-week text/voice support, and full app access.
3. The Transition
Once the structure that best fits you is chosen, I handle the logistics so you can fully lean into the healing work:
Locking Your Spot: We secure a permanent recurring day and time in my calendar. No rushing to book online slots; your momentum is entirely protected.
Activating Your Toolbox: You get instant access to my private resource app, packed with custom somatic grounding tools and maps tailored to your blueprint.
Set-and-Forget Billing: Weekly payments run automatically via GoCardless, (to avoid those pesky credit card fees). We never waste energy or break the therapeutic energy handling money at the end of a deep session.
4. Continuous Care & Maintenance
Healing happens out in the world, not just on the therapy couch. During our 60-minute sessions, we do the heavy lifting. In the spaces between, you have direct access to me via WhatsApp.
If a pattern spikes or life gets overwhelming, you send a voice note, and I help you track and regulate it right then and there.
5. Maintenance Pathway
Once your system has beautifully integrated these shifts and you feel ready to fly solo, we smoothly transition you out of the container and onto our ad-hoc Maintenance Pathway for casual, flexible check-ins whenever you need them.
Containers run on an initial 3-month commitment to give your biology the runway it needs to build a permanent baseline of safety. Once your system has beautifully integrated these shifts, we transition you onto our ad-hoc Maintenance Pathway ($220 per casual session) for flexible, casual check-ins whenever you need a tune-up & ongoing access to the app for $29 a month, if you wish to continue with your at home practice.
